Program Description
The Associate of Science in Digital Media Technology (DMT) degree prepares students to design, create and deliver content using digital media technologies.
Delivery Mode
Traditional (on campus)
Accreditation
The program has national accreditation from the Accrediting Council for Collegiate Graphic Communication (ACCGC).
